## Account Recovery — Trailnote Offline Mode

When a surveyor's Trailnote app has been offline for 30+ days, their local credentials expire and sync refuses to resume. Don't make them wipe the device — all their unsynced field data lives there! Instead, open the support console, pick "Offline Reinstate," and enter their handle. The console will ask for the support team's shared recovery passphrase before issuing a reinstatement token. Use the one below.

unlock words, bagaf-fajeg: zorael-kelax-fraath-quenix-eliok-sileth-aldmir-wenir-druiel

## Compensate for thermistor drift in GrowMesh controllers

This PR adds a rolling-median filter to the GrowMesh climate loop, correcting the slow upward drift we observed in long-running Verdella greenhouse deployments. Plugin authors should note that raw sensor reads are now smoothed before callbacks fire. The filter behaviour is governed by the constants below.

tuning table, yajog-yahof:
BUDGETS = {
    "lamvan": 303,
    "wenox": 460,
    "fenvan": 525,
}

Subject: Muffler dedup — on-call basics

Welcome to the rotation. Muffler collapses duplicate pages before they hit the pager queue. For your security review: it stores alert fingerprints for 24h, no payload bodies. Suppression rules are signed; unsigned rules are ignored. If dedup misfires, disable the offending rule rather than the service. Escalation order: you, then Priya, then the Reliability lead. Audit logs, rule signing details, and the threat model are documented on the internal page here.

runbook for badug-kadup: https://confluence.zemvarlabs.internal/projects/browse/display/projects/bd1b

Handover: Memlens profiler

Handing Memlens support over to you all this week. It captures GPU allocation snapshots on the Torvane fleet and flags leaks over a rolling window. Most tickets are false positives from short-lived training jobs; the triage doc covers those. Ollie fixed the sampler crash last sprint, so that's closed. The agent currently runs with these settings.

deployment values, bagag-bawig:
DRUVAN_PIN=0740
DRUVAN_TENANT=wendor
DRUVAN_METRICS_HOST=metrics.druvan.tolvaqnet.example
DRUVAN_SEAL=seal_75cd0b2d
DRUVAN_STANDBY_TEAM=tamael